1. CSDN博客推荐 140款Android开源优秀项目源码:详细解析了商城系统的构建,包括服务端和客户端的实现细节。 GitHub上最火的22个Android开源项目源码:包括隐私通信工具、视频播放器、图片显示控件等,项目均超万星。 9个完整Android开源app项目:介绍了多个流行的Android和iOS开源项目。
2. Gitee推荐 Android热门项目:展示了各种优秀的Android开源项目,包括UI框架、支付开发包、视频播放器、聊天系统等。
3. 知乎推荐 53个Android开源项目分享:分享了各类顶尖的设计项目,适合Android开发者学习和参考。
4. 博客园推荐 20 个很棒的Android开源项目:涵盖了多种实用和炫酷的功能,如动态主题、文件选择器等。
5. 其他推荐 Android酷炫实用的开源框架:介绍了多个UI框架,如图表绘制库、下拉刷新等。 Android快速开发框架推荐:对比了多个开发框架,如Afinal、xUtils、ThinkAndroid等。
这些开源项目涵盖了从基础组件到完整应用的各种需求,可以帮助开发者快速学习和提升技能。
深入解析安卓开源项目:发展历程、核心优势与未来展望
安卓开源项目(Android Open Source Project,简称AOSP)是当今全球最受欢迎的移动操作系统之一——安卓的基石。本文将深入探讨安卓开源项目的发展历程、核心优势以及未来的发展趋势。
安卓开源项目起源于2005年,当时谷歌收购了安卓公司,并开始研发安卓操作系统。2007年,谷歌发布了安卓的第一个版本——安卓1.0,随后迅速在市场上获得了广泛的关注和认可。2008年,谷歌正式将安卓开源,并成立了安卓开源项目。
安卓开源项目之所以能够取得如此巨大的成功,主要得益于以下几个核心优势:
1. 开源性质
安卓开源项目的开源性质使得全球的开发者可以自由地使用、修改和分发安卓代码,这极大地促进了安卓生态系统的繁荣。
2. 丰富的生态系统
安卓开源项目拥有庞大的生态系统,包括各种手机厂商、应用开发者、硬件供应商等,共同推动了安卓的发展。
3. 高度可定制性
安卓开源项目允许用户和开发者根据自己的需求进行定制,这使得安卓系统可以适应各种不同的设备和场景。
4. 强大的兼容性
安卓开源项目基于Linux内核,具有强大的兼容性,可以运行在多种硬件平台上。
安卓开源项目具有以下技术特点:
1. 基于Linux内核
安卓开源项目采用Linux内核,保证了系统的稳定性和安全性。
2. Java语言开发
安卓开源项目主要使用Java语言进行开发,这使得开发者可以轻松地迁移自己的Java应用。
3. 多任务处理
安卓开源项目支持多任务处理,用户可以同时运行多个应用程序。
4. 高度集成
安卓开源项目集成了多种功能,如GPS、摄像头、传感器等,为用户提供丰富的体验。
随着移动互联网的快速发展,安卓开源项目在未来仍将扮演着重要的角色。以下是安卓开源项目未来可能的发展趋势:
1. 生态持续繁荣
随着越来越多的开发者和企业加入安卓开源项目,安卓生态系统将持续繁荣,为用户提供更多优质的应用和服务。
2. 技术创新
安卓开源项目将继续在技术上进行创新,如人工智能、物联网等领域,以满足用户不断变化的需求。
3. 安全性提升
随着网络安全问题的日益突出,安卓开源项目将更加注重系统的安全性,为用户提供更加安全的体验。
4. 跨平台发展
安卓开源项目有望进一步拓展到其他平台,如智能家居、可穿戴设备等,实现跨平台发展。
安卓开源项目作为全球最受欢迎的移动操作系统之一,其发展历程、核心优势以及未来展望都值得深入探讨。随着移动互联网的快速发展,安卓开源项目将继续引领全球移动操作系统的发展潮流。